Huskers win five Nebraska advertising awards

Friday, February 17, 2023 - 4:30pm

Students in UNL’s College of Journalism and Mass Communications brought home four silver awards and one gold award at the 2023 Nebraska Advertising Awards on Friday, Feb. 10.

Each year, the Nebraska Advertising Awards recognize the best and brightest ads and campaigns created by Nebraska businesses and advertising agencies. American Advertising Federation Omaha (AAF Omaha) and American Advertising Federation Lincoln (AAF Lincoln) members are recognized and rewarded for their creative excellence in what has become the industry’s largest and most respected competition.

The local awards are the first of the three-tier, national competition. In the second tier, local winners compete against other winners in 14 district competitions held concurrently across the country. District winners are then forwarded to the third tier, the American Advertising Awards.
